Auditing Associate applicants have rated the interview process at KPMG with 2 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 84.2%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Auditing Associate roles take an average of 26 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at KPMG overall takes an average of 17 days.
Common stages of the interview process at KPMG as a Auditing Associate according to 2 Glassdoor interviews include:
One on one interview: 67%
Phone interview: 33%

I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at KPMG (Petaling Jaya) in Jul 2021
Interview
Applied online on their website. Did some online assessment like personality test and english test. After 2 weeks or so i received phone interview but just a basic conversation to know which industry do i prefer and why kpmg. Few days later got called for an online iv with senior audit manager. I would say the iv was really relaxing and chill just like a normal chit chat. My interviewer is really nice and he made sure i feel comfortable.
